delete() public method

Create a delete statement
public delete ( ) : Update
return Pop\Db\Sql\Update
Example #1
0
 public function testDelete()
 {
     $s = new Sql(Db::factory('Sqlite', array('database' => __DIR__ . '/../tmp/test.sqlite')), 'users');
     $s->delete()->orderBy('id')->limit(1);
     $this->assertEquals('DELETE FROM "users" ORDER BY "id" ASC LIMIT 1', $s->render(true));
 }
Example #2
0
 /**
  * Method to delete a value in cache.
  *
  * @param  string $id
  * @return void
  */
 public function remove($id)
 {
     $this->sqlite->delete()->where()->equalTo('id', $this->sqlite->adapter()->escape(sha1($id)));
     $this->sqlite->adapter()->query($this->sqlite->render(true));
 }